WHO WE ARE 

Pack 108 is part of the Ramapo Valley District of the Northern New Jersey Council of the Boy Scouts of America. Our Pack is primarily represented by boys attending the WayneSchool grades K-5.  We are sponsored by Our Lady of the Valley RC Church in Wayne, NJ on Valley Road.

WHEN WE MEET

Den meetings are held once a month for the Lion and Tiger Dens (entry level) and all other Dens meet twice a month.  Additional activities and special programs may be scheduled as needed for specific Den requirements.

Monthly Pack meetings occur one Friday per Month.  All Dens participate in the Pack meetings and include parent participation to plan activities as well as entertainment and food.

Pack meetings are held at Our Lady of the Valley RC Church.

 

SCOUT FUN



Camping
:On an annual basis we ha
ve two Camping Trips (one in the fall and one in the spring) that we go on as an entire Pack (all Dens).  You need not be an experienced camper to enjoy the weekends.  Everyone helps each other and we especially enjoy the fun activities that take place around the campfire. 

 


Pinewood Derby
: Every March, we conduct our annual
Pinewood Derby in which the boys build their own cars from the kit that is provided by the Pack. This is a great father and son activity which always is the highlight of the Scout season.  We award the top 3 finishers from each Den as well as recognize all the boys with an award based on the different categories (i.e. Best Design).

 

Trips - The Pack plans a few trips throughout the year.  Typical trips might include: Turtle Back Zoo, Maple Sugaring, Passaic County Sheriff's Office, Lakota Wolf Preserve,  New Jersey Aviation Hall of Fame, The Intrepid Museum, etc.  

 

                                                                   

 

                                                                                                                              COMMUNITY ACTIVITIES

Scouting for Food: Scouting for Food is a nationwide effort by the Boy Scouts of America. Each Spring, Cub Scout Packs, Boy Scout Troops and Venturing Crews fan out across America to collect donations of food to help those in need, and current statistics reflect that 9% of people right here in New Jersey go hungry each day.  We collect donations of food in front of local Wayne stores usually at the supermarkets. All of the food we collect will again be donated to, and distributed to those in need by, the Community Food bank of New Jersey.

Support our Troops: We have taken time out during our monthly Pack meetings to collect food and other items to send over to the troops serving in Iraq and Afghanistan. Last year, the Pack got readily involved and was able to obtain a nice assortment of items. The entire Pack all chipped in and helped to pack up the collected items for the troops. It is a very fun evening and we are looking forward to doing this annually.
